Netbula LLC v. Chordiant Software Inc.

In a 2009 case called "Netbula, LLC v. Chordiant Software Inc.", defendant Chordiant Software Inc. filed a motion to compel Plaintiff Netbula to remove the robots.txt file that has been in place since "[s]everal years ago." A person from Internet Archive filed a declaration stating that it could not produce the web pages "without considerable burden, expense and disruption to its operations." Netbula objected on the ground that defendants' motion was not a motion to compel but the motion to alter record, similar to an injunction. Plaintiff also contends that it has exclusive property rights to its copyrighted web content[15], which could be affected by the Field v. Google case. Magistrate Judge Howard Lloyd in the Northern District of California, San Jose Division, rejected these arguments and ordered that "Plaintiffs shall, within three days from the entry of this order, disable the robot.txt file from its website and promptly advise defense counsel
when that has been accomplished." [16] See also, Jenkins-Laporte Doctrine.
